One Pot Zucchini Orzo
One Pot Zucchini Orzo is a simple side dish that comes together in under 30 minutes with only 10 ingredients. Light, fresh and delicious!

Ingredients
1
tablespoon
extra virgin olive oil
1
tablespoon
minced garlic
1
cup
dry orzo pasta
2
tablespoons
white wine
1 ¾
cups
chicken stock
3
cups
diced zucchini
¼
teaspoon
salt
¼
teaspoon
black pepper
½
cup
grated Parmesan cheese
¼
cup
chopped fresh basil
Instructions
Heat the olive oil in a large sauté pan over medium heat for 3-4 minutes.
Add the garlic to the pan and cook for two minutes or until translucent.
Add the orzo and white wine to the pan and cook for 1 minute, stirring constantly.
Add the chicken stock to the pan and stir. Cover with a lid and cook for 4 minutes, stirring occasionally so the orzo doesn't stick.
Stir in the chopped zucchini, black pepper and salt. Cover with a lid and cook for an additional 4 minutes.
Remove the lid from the pan. Stir in Parmesan cheese and fresh basil.
Optional: You can drizzle an additional 1 tablespoon of olive oil to the pot before serving for finishing.
Serve warm with extra Parmesan cheese and crushed red pepper.
